Insider tips

  • Arrive early in the morning to beat crowds and enjoy cooler temperatures while walking between sites
  • Wear comfortable walking shoes with good grip—Palatine Hill has uneven ancient stone paths
  • Your guide will share lesser-known details about daily Roman life that aren't on museum plaques

Good to know

  • 2 hours 30 minutes total; mostly outdoors on historic terrain with some stairs and uneven ground
  • Small groups capped at 15 people for quality interaction with your guide
  • Bring water, sun protection, and comfortable walking shoes; limited shade at some stops

Best time to visit

Early morning (8–9 AM) offers the best combination of cooler weather, smaller crowds, and better photography light. Spring (April–May) and autumn (September–October) provide ideal temperatures for a full walking tour.
